Seven year pitch

It has been seven years since Nick and Chris Giles took over the management of their father's business and their growth plans are right on target, finds Angela Faherty.

When Nick and Chris Giles took over the management of Giles Insurance
Brokers from their father in 1995, they had big plans for growth. The
company had four branches and 60 employees and was a relatively small,
family-owned and run business. Today, the company has 13 branches
throughout the UK and employs over 200 people.


Giles Insurance Brokers has a five-year business plan and hopes to have
offices in 20 locations by the end of its financial year in August
2005.
